**Beam** is an ultrafast AI inference platform. We built a serverless runtime that launches GPU-backed containers in less than 1 second and quickly scales out to thousands of GPUs. Developers use our platform to serve apps to millions of users around the globe. # **About the Role**

We're building out our own GPU capacity across new data center sites, and we need someone to stand up that infrastructure and drive deployments to completion.

* Deploy and validate data center network infrastructure (front-end, back-end, BMS, management): configure switches, install and validate optics, coordinate cabling, and drive deployments to completion.
* Ensure physical connectivity meets production standards: coordinate fiber remediation, validate insertion loss and OTDR traces, troubleshoot optical-layer issues, and document as-builts.
* Manage hardware logistics: device staging, rack/stack coordination, RMA, DCIM updates, inventory, and vendor shipments so devices are ready when deployments need them.
* Partner with DC Operations, ICT, Hardware, and Network Engineering to identify blockers early, escalate decisively, and keep multi-team efforts on track.
* Maintain cutsheets, as-builts, validation results, and lessons learned, and contribute to the deployment playbook that lets the team scale.
* Provide operational support during and after deployments: incident response, troubleshooting, and break-fix.

# Skills & Experience

* Hands-on data center network engineering and understanding of modern fabrics (EVPN/VXLAN, BGP, CLOS), having configured production infrastructure.
* You thrive in the field, equally comfortable pulling cable, configuring switches, and troubleshooting the optical layer, and you execute with whatever tooling is available.
* You troubleshoot methodically across physical and logical layers: OTDR traces, insertion loss, BGP sessions, and connectivity through complex topologies.
* You communicate clearly across technical and non-technical teams, document well, and follow through.
* You learn fast and take ownership of ramping on new technology, and you'll travel 50 to 60% to onsite deployments.
* Bonus: AI fabric turn-up experience. Configuration management and automation tooling. Vendor certifications.
